Software Quality Assurance Lead
Responsibilities:
- Design Test Strategy, Test Plans, Architecting automation Frameworks, Scenarios, Scripts.
- Document Test Procedures to ensure replicability and compliance with standards
- Document all the program changes, system modifications to prepare release notes
- Identify, analyze, and document problems with program function, output, online screen, or content.
- Conduct Software compatibility, Regression, smoke, Functional and Non-functional tests
- Provide Feedback and recommendations to developers on software usability and functionality.
- Review software documentation to ensure technical accuracy, compliance, or completeness, or to mitigate risks
- Create and execute performance tests to ensure efficient and problem-free operations and met all SLA’s
- Performing Automation Testing to improve Software Quality and create good quality test data.
- Code Coverage handled with deep checks making sure third-party accessibility is authenticated as per enterprise level.
- Automation Test Scripts are executed continuously, and results are posted in Quality Hub.
- Debug backend queries, database issues, network and file system related issues and report bugs with required details
- Coordinate user for UAT testing or third-party integration testing
- Document Software defects, using a bug tracing system, and report defects to software developers
- Investigate customer/Production issues, work closely with production support, Release management, customer teams to collect information and reproduce bugs in lower environments
- Participate in bug triage process and monitor bug resolution efforts and track successes
- Review the project plan and project schedule.
- Meeting with stakeholders, Share the test plan with project stake holders and get their feed backs and approvals.
- Escalating any critical / showstopper issues to the project stake holders.
- Perform Load / Functional Testing
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s Degree is required in Computer Science or Computer Engineering or Information Technology or Software Systems
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ills

SAP AVC Consultant
- Deep hands-on AVC model building experience within a complex manufacturing environment
- Has deep functional understanding of SAP Advance Variant Configuration software, best practices, and relevant cross-functional knowledge of SD, MM, PP, FI/CO SAP modules and the integration points with AVC.
- Thorough understanding of all aspects of Advance Variant Configuration product model including classes, characteristics, configuration profiles, ALE, tables, variant pricing, functions, dependency nets with constraints, BOM class nodes, preconditions, selection conditions, procedures, complex super bills of material and routes and work centers.
- Hands on experience with CTO / ETO End to End process
- Experience with Classic VC (LO-VC) to AVC conversion
- Intergration with CPS/CPQ cloud
- Expertise in Order BOM and Engineering Change Management (ECM) is very helpful.
- Help design product model architecture to ensure best balance of maintainability, scalability, and system performance.
- Facilitate business process and master data alignment with SAP best practices for AVC.
- Gather, validate, and document AVC product model specifications from product experts at business units
- Provide functional specifications for enhancements, interfaces, forms, and reports to support AVC business requirements
- Ability to ensure strong alignment between the business requirements/needs and the application solutions/services.
Quality Control Systems Manager
Quality Control Systems Manager is needed to perform the following duties:
Direct and manage enterprise-wide SAP S/4 quality control systems as an overall SAP S/4 Quality Specialist, covering SAP S/4HANA Finance, Logistics, FIORI, integrations, reporting, automation, performance, SIT, UAT, regression testing, and production-readiness validation across the SAP landscape.
-
- Establish quality strategy, governance model, quality gates, test standards, entry/exit criteria, and release readiness controls.
- Lead global SAP quality delivery across business, functional, technical, automation, performance, and offshore/onshore teams.
- Ensure SAP releases meet defined quality control standards before production deployment.
Develop, implement, and enforce SAP quality policies, test procedures, defect control processes, audit-ready documentation standards, and corrective/preventive action practices for large-scale SAP programs.
-
- Define test plan templates, RTM standards, defect triage protocols, test evidence rules, closure report requirements, and quality sign-off procedures.
- Maintain quality dashboards using HP ALM, JIRA, Q-Test, and related management tools.
- Ensure testing artifacts provide management visibility, traceability, and audit readiness.
Lead quality planning, inspection design, and risk-based validation across the overall SAP S/4 landscape, including Finance, Controlling, Logistics, FIORI, integrations, GL, AP, AR, Asset Accounting, RE-FX/Lease Accounting, PTP, TCM, SCM, and T&E processes.
-
- Define inspection methods for postings, reconciliations, payment runs, billing, clearing, aging, depreciation, intercompany activity, period-end close, and financial reporting.
- Translate business requirements and functional specifications into measurable acceptance criteria and test coverage.
- Validate accuracy, completeness, and control effectiveness across SAP financial processes and integrations.
Manage SAP Testing Center of Excellence activities as a SAP QA/Test Lead, including test strategy ownership, test execution oversight, quality governance, resource planning, test estimation, and stakeholder reporting across multiple concurrent SAP programs.
-
- Lead SAP quality teams, including teams of 5, 10, and 15 members across onsite-offshore delivery models.
- Assign testing work, guide QA analysts, review execution progress, remove blockers, and ensure team members follow approved SAP test procedures.
- Review and approve test plans, coverage reports, dashboards, defect reports, closure reports, and quality sign-off documentation.
- Provide leadership updates, quality risk summaries, and go/no-go recommendations.
Plan, direct, and control SIT, UAT, functional, integration, regression, automation, performance, and hypercare validation activities as a SAP test lead for SAP releases and transformation milestones.
-
- Lead execution governance for hundreds of SAP test scenarios and manage readiness across SIT-1, SIT-2, UAT, and regression cycles.
- Coordinate testers, business users, functional consultants, automation resources, and offshore teams to complete assigned test execution within schedule and quality expectations.
- Enable business users through structured UAT training, execution support, daily status tracking, and defect handling.
- Control production transition through quality metrics, sign-off, and hypercare readiness validation.
Own defect lifecycle management, root cause analysis, corrective action tracking, retesting controls, and quality trend analysis to prevent recurring SAP production issues.
-
- Chair daily defect triage meetings and manage severity, priority, ownership, resolution, and closure quality.
- Analyze defect root causes, batch processing failures, interface issues, and process-control gaps.
- Implement corrective and preventive actions to improve release quality and reduce future defects.
Design and govern SAP test automation strategy, architecture, framework, coverage model, execution standards, and automation quality reporting using TOSCA, Worksoft Certify, and Selenium.
- Build automation frameworks from scratch for SAP regression and integration testing.
- Select automation candidates, review automation coverage, validate execution results, review TOSCA, Worksoft Certify, and Selenium automation scripts for technical accuracy, control coverage, maintainability, and reusability, and approve automation scripts before inclusion in reusable SAP regression suites.
- Use automation outcomes as objective quality evidence for SAP release decisions
- Design and direct SAP performance quality systems, including workload modeling, KPI benchmarks, baseline methodology, bottleneck analysis, optimization recommendations, and performance-readiness certification for go-live.
- Establish performance test strategy and acceptance criteria for SAP RISE and global S/4HANA programs.
- Lead tool selection, stakeholder buy-in, licensing considerations, scalability planning, and test factory execution.
- Certify production readiness based on performance evidence, usage patterns, and quality risk evaluation.
- Evaluate SAP system changes, enhancements, integrations, migrations, and release scope to determine risk, test impact, quality control requirements, and required regression coverage.
- Conduct risk-based test planning for SAP Finance, Logistics, FIORI, ECC-to-HANA, third-party integrations, and data flows.
- Define regression pack scope and change validation controls for every release cycle.
- Escalate quality risks, schedule risks, control gaps, and unresolved defects to program leadership.
- Manage quality inspection and validation for financial data, integration accuracy, reconciliation outcomes, system interfaces, batch processing, reporting, and business process controls.
- Validate SAP-to-third-party integrations such as Concur, DocuWare, Kyriba, OANDA, and related finance-processing systems.
- Ensure source-to-target accuracy, reconciliation completeness, posting correctness, clearing accuracy, and reporting reliability.
- Escalate data defects and process-control failures for corrective action
- Prepare and present quality performance reports, dashboards, defect analytics, RTM reports, execution metrics, performance results, automation coverage, risk logs, and release readiness summaries to program leadership.
- Provide daily and weekly management reporting on quality status, schedule risk, defect health, and unresolved blockers.
- Summarize test matrices, dashboards, coverage reports, and closure reports for leadership review.
- Support go/no-go decisions using measurable quality evidence.
- Coordinate with business owners, SAP functional consultants, architects, developers, integration teams, automation engineers, performance engineers, client leadership, and offshore delivery teams to resolve quality issues and maintain governance compliance.
- Lead stakeholder meetings, test status calls, business reviews, defect triage sessions, release planning meetings, and quality closure reviews.
- Ensure cross-functional alignment on test scope, readiness, corrective actions, ownership, and release decisions.
- Manage communication between business and technical teams to protect SAP quality outcomes.
- Train, mentor, supervise, and lead QA team members and business users on SAP quality standards, test execution procedures, defect documentation, automation execution, financial validation methods, and release evidence requirements.
- Guide QA teams in SAP FI/CO, MM, SD, RE-FX, SIT, UAT, regression, automation, and performance test practices.
- Lead team-level test execution meetings, assign responsibilities, review team deliverables, and ensure compliance with defined quality procedures.
- Promote consistent quality practices across global SAP delivery teams.
- Continuously improve SAP quality control systems by identifying process gaps, automation opportunities, performance risks, defect trends, testing inefficiencies, control weaknesses, and release-governance improvements.
- Recommend process improvements to increase testing effectiveness, reduce cycle time, improve coverage, and prevent production defects.
- Standardize quality governance models across manual, automation, performance, SIT, UAT, and regression scopes.
- Drive measurable improvements in SAP delivery predictability, release confidence, and quality outcomes
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s Degree is required in Computer Science OR Computer Engineering OR Computer Information Systems
